Andrew F. Kalmar: (South Bend Tribune 4/3/1995)

Oct. 13, 1920-April 1, 1995 SOUTH BEND - Andrew F. Kalmar, 74, of Crown Hill Drive, died at 10:21 p.m. Saturday in Memorial Hospital of natural causes. Mr. Kalmar retired in 1985 after over 44 years as a tool and die maker for Adams Engineering. He was born Oct. 13, 1920, in South Bend and was a lifelong resident. On May 1, 1976 in South Bend, he married Lorraine J. Nowicki. She survives with two sons, Andrew F. Jr. of Cape Coral, Fla., and Daniel G. of Mishawaka, two step daughters, Roberta K. Harvey and Janice L. Laskowski, both of South Bend, nine grandchildren, four sisters, Marge Kalmar, Mary McCarthy and Barbara Kenna, all of South Bend, and Gizella Horwarth of Mishwaka; and a brother, George of South Bend. He was a Navy veteran of World War II and was a member of Veterans of Foreign War and the American Legion. Services will be at 10 a.m. Wednesday in Forest G. Hay Funeral Home, 435 S. Ironwood Drive. Burial will be in Highland Cemetery. Friends may call from 2 to 4 and 6 to 9 p.m. Tuesday in the funeral home.
